Dornan Amendment Change to Allow Local Funds for Abortion |
 |
 |
Prayer-Soldier writes "A 9 Dec 09 FOX News report related that Congressional negotiators have come to an agreement on a $1.1 trillion dollar spending bill that would include changes to the Dornan Amendment that currently prohibits taxpayer funding of abortion within Washington, DC. The report related that the bill would change the Dornan Amendment to add the word “federal” to the current abortion prohibition such that the language of the amendment would no longer prohibit the use of local taxpayer funds for abortions.
According to a 9 Dec 09 AP report posted by MSNBC, “The bill reflects Democrats' control of Congress and the White House” in that the bill would allow Washington DC government to use local taxpayer money to fund abortion.
In a 1 Jul 09 Townhall.com report, President Obama was identified as directly responsible for the change. The report related that “wording in the “Dornan Amendment” was altered to read: “None of the [Federal] funds appropriated under this Act shall be expended for any abortion except where the life of the mother would be endangered if the fetus were carried to term or where the pregnancy is the result of an act of rape or incest.”
A 24 Jun 09 CBN.com report related that a group of pro-life women in the House of Representatives protested the Obama administration's effort to change the pro-life amendment. The report commented that the House Pro-Life Women's Caucus pointed out that with President Obama's actions were hypocrital in the face of his statements that he sought to reduce the number of abortions. The report quoted Marjorie Dannenfelser of the Susan B. Anthony List as saying, “What would DC funding of abortions do? What would taxpayer funding do? It would increase abortions in the District of Columbia by at least 1,000 abortions per year. Now this is not a strategy for reducing abortion because common sense tells us that if you fund something you're going to get more of it.”
